You will be able to put your fans email addresses on a list that will reach them using the ‘custom audiences’ feature. This will help laser focus certain marketing messages you send out. Special deals devoted to previous customers, for instance. It will save you time and money.

Make sure your Facebook page isn’t being inundated with spam. Sites that are riddled with spam can end up turning potential customers off. Anyone who has administrative rights to your page can filter out specified keywords simply by entering them into this tool.

Using Facebook Offers, you can quickly promote a contest or freebie which you are offering on your website. Once the offer is ready, change it on your wall so it shows as a Promoted Post. If it’s a good deal, you can give it to people that do not even like your page yet.

A great way to boost conversion of visitors to followers is by hiding content from those who are not yet fans. If you are able to hide part of your page so that only followers are able to view it, then casual visitors are more likely to join up. Leave a good portion of your content visible for both SEO and enticement.

Using “custom audiences”, you can upload the email addresses of your current customers and then target your ads towards them only. This boosts your conversion rates and keeps down your campaign costs as many people advertise to change their leads into full sales on the site.

For business that sell items like cars or major appliances that are purchased infrequently, a Facebook page for their business might not be the best answer. Customers tend not to follow such pages unless they actually need the item. Try making your ads on Facebook.
